
Bought one of these to measure the thickness of convex metal parts. The build quality is good. It's a pretty accurate tool, at least for my purposes. I love how I can pinch it onto a metal plate, bowl, wooden board or similar object by moving the sponges over the object's surface to find areas that are too thick and simply displaying on the watch the LCD screen. . The spacing of the jaws ranges from 0 to 19cm and a 1mm thick piece of metal with a rim of about 5cm by 5cm can reasonably be measured between the jaws ie if you imagine a 5cm by 5cm square torus you can Bring the jaws over and fully close the jaws in the center of the torus. A fairly major annoyance is that the little cart that fits into the side of the blue case doesn't snap into place, causing me to lose the thing when I unnoticed slipped the battery out of its recess. I found the thing again, put the container in the device and taped it in place, problem solved. Still, for the price, it's a pretty good device, at least for my purposes.
